Status
Released
Release
March 14, 2025
Languages
English
Video recorded on May 12, 2023 at the Arcada Theatre in St. Charles, IL and May 13, 2023 at the Des Plaines Theatre in Des Plaines, IL.
Jon Anderson
Himself